Battery The battery inside the battery of your Porsche key fob is a key element in the operation. It allows you to lock or unlock your vehicle using remote controls. As porsche coding passes the battery in your Porsche key fob is likely to run out of power and will require replacement. It is simple to change the battery on your key fob. Here are some guidelines to get you started. Then, flip your Porsche key and search for the emergency key. It's usually in the lower part of your key casing. It is accessible by pressing a button at the bottom. Then, grab your plastic prytool , and then carefully remove the base of the key fob to the point where it connects to the key. This will let the key fob's dark, circular piece of plastic to fall off. After the emergency key is removed, you can remove the battery you have been using and replace it with the new one. Make sure that the new battery is facing the right direction before turning it on. For the majority of Porsche key fobs, it is necessary to have a CR2032 Lithium 3 Volt battery that is typically available at your local pharmacy or hardware store. It's about $5 and lasts about 4-12 years , depending on how much you use it. It is possible to replace the battery if your key fob has a strange behavior it is not working at all or acting oddly.
